We are looking for an experienced Data Quality Analyst to join the national digital health transformation program in Qatar. This role will support the implementation of data quality frameworks and ensure the consistency, completeness, and accuracy of health-related data across national healthcare systems.

You will work closely with the Health Data Quality & Standards Expert to monitor data pipelines, validate health datasets, and enforce best practices in healthcare data management.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form data profiling, cleansing, and validation of clinical and operational datasets
  • Identify anomalies, duplicates, and inconsistencies in healthcare data
  • Collaborate with integration teams to ensure data quality across systems (EMRs, LIS, HIE)
  • Monitor KPIs and create dashboards to track data quality metrics (completeness, timeliness, accuracy)
  • Support implementation of data quality rules, metadata standards, and integrity checks
  • Document data quality issues, perform root cause analysis, and recommend remediation steps
  • Participate in user acceptance testing (UAT) of data-related features
  • Work closely with business analysts, developers, and informatics experts
  • Assist in defining data dictionaries, value sets, and clinical terminology mappings
  • Create reports and visualizations using BI tools (Power BI, Excel, or equivalent)

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Health Informatics, or related field
  • 1+ years of experience in data analysis, quality control, or healthcare data environments
  • Strong knowledge of SQL, data querying, and reporting tools
  • Familiarity with HL7, FHIR, or clinical data exchange standards is a strong plus
  • Experience working with Power BI, Tableau, or other dashboarding tools
  • Understanding of healthcare workflows, EMR data, and clinical coding systems (ICD, SNOMED) is desirable
  • Excellent documentation and communication skills

Preferred Experience

  • Experience in healthcare or public sector data projects
  • Exposure to data quality frameworks, DQ rule engines, or data governance tools
  • Ability to analyze structured/unstructured clinical data

Job Summary

We are seeking an experienced Data Governance Consultant to lead and support the execution of data governance and compliance initiatives across the enterprise. This role involves close collaboration with data owners, stewards, business units, and IT teams to ensure data is well-managed, secure, and aligned with business, regulatory, and strategic objectives. The ideal candidate will have deep knowledge of data governance frameworks, data quality, metadata management, and regulatory compliance (e.g., GDPR), along with strong analytical and communication skills.

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ary support for data managers across the organization in day-to-day data governance operations.
  • Develop, implement, and maintain enterprise-wide data governance frameworks, policies, standards, and processes.
  • Define and document data definitions, business metadata, ownership, lineage, and usage rules.
  • Act as a functional expert with a deep understanding of data domains and related business processes.
  • Assist in establishing data stewardship models and roles across departments.
  • Monitor data quality, conduct assessments, define business rules, and coordinate remediation activities.
  • Support implementation and configuration of data governance and catalog tools (e.g., Collibra, Informatica Axon, Alation).
  • Assist in defining frameworks for new data governance teams and operating models for client organizations.
  • Collaborate on major projects to ensure compliance with data protection regulations such as GDPR and CCPA.
  • Identify and implement control points for compliance auditing and data privacy enforcement.
  • Participate in internal audits to validate adherence to data governance policies and identify process improvement opportunities.
  • Drive awareness and adoption of data governance practices through training materials, workshops, and stakeholder engagement.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ives related to metadata management, data classification, security, and policy enforcement.
  • Track and report data governance KPIs, maturity levels, and compliance metrics.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Information Management, Computer Science, Business, or related field.
  • 4-6 years of experience in data governance, data management, or data privacy roles.
  • Solid knowledge of data governance frameworks and best practices (e.g., DAMA-DMBOK).
  • Familiarity with data quality principles, metadata management, and business glossary development.
  • Hands-on experience with data governance platforms such as Collibra, Informatica Axon, Alation, etc.
  • Strong documentation, stakeholder management,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work cross-functionally and collaboratively with both technical and business teams.
  • Self-starter with strong business acumen and understanding of enterprise data domains.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Professional certifications (e.g., CDMP, DGSP, or equivalent).
  • Experience in regulated industries such as finance, healthcare, or insurance.
  • Knowledge of data privacy regulations (e.g., GDPR, CCPA) and compliance practices.
  • Exposure to cloud data environments (e.g., Azure, AWS, GCP) and modern data architectures.
